Travis "The Serial Killer" Lutter Released from the UFC


ex ufc fighter travis lutter - black background - ultimate fightting championship Travis "The Serial Killer" Lutter announced on Sunday, via his MySpace account, that he had been released from his UFC contract.

According to Lutter himself, Joe Silva contacted Lutter's manager and informed him that Lutter's services were no longer required with the company, due to his back-to-back losses.

Many people had speculated before the Rich Franklin - Travis Lutter fight at UFC 83 that Lutter would be released from his contract if he lost. This is exactly what happened, as Franklin knocked out Lutter midway through the second round. This followed Lutter's second round loss to Anderson Silva at UFC 67. The UFC decided that they had had enough of Lutter, and released him halfway through his contract.

Lutter has a lifetime professional record of 9-5-0, with seven of his victories coming via submission. He first appeared in the UFC in 2004, scoring a victory against Marvin Eastman via knockout. After a unanimous decision loss to Trevor Prangley at UFC 54 - Boiling Point, Lutter left the company.

He re-appeared during the fourth season of the Ultimate Fighter, scoring a victory against Patrick Cote in the finale. This led to a six-fight contract and a match against Anderson "Spider" Silva, in which he was knocked out (as mentioned). The UFC cut Lutter just two fights into his six fight deal, and Lutter becomes the first Ultimate Fighter winner to be cut by the promotion.

Lutter got on the wrong side of UFC management after failing to make weight for his fight against Silva. This meant that a once-in-a-lifetime title shot was blown, as the fight became a non-title bout. This certainly didn't endear Lutter to UFC management and fans, and meant that Lutter would need an extremely strong showing against Rich Franklin to redeem himself. As usual with Lutter, he started strong but became gassed in the second round, eventually succumbing to Franklin via knockout in the second round.

It is unlikely that Lutter will get a third shot with the UFC. He has the potential to be a great middleweight fighter but needs to greatly improve his conditioning. Lutter will likely be forever known as the guy who had the opportunity to fight for a UFC title but threw it away due to not being able to make weight.
